I just got a LG IPS234v 23 inch IPS, very good for the price $160 (aus) and has a vesa mount 75x75. I use it as side monitor just playing movies or music clips so im not to sure how good it is for gaming but LG claims it has a 5ms response time ( I'm assuming thats grey to grey). Mainly got it cause it was cheap and IPS and I needed to mount it as i have no desk space, otherwise im happy with the colours and clarity.
